A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Y OF JEFFERSON, MISSOURI, REPEALING
SUBSECTIONS (e ) AND ( f ) OF SECTION 11-36 OF THE CODE OF THE CITY
OF JEFFERSON, MISSOURI , DEFINING THE BOUNDARIES OF THE FOURTH AND
FIFTH WARDS AND ENACTING TWO NEW SUBSECTIONS PERTAINING TO THE
SAME SUBJECT.
W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Jefferson did, on May 5,
1987 , duly enact Ordinance No. 10820 which annexed land to the
south and established ward boundaries in the south area; and
WHEREAS, the ward boundaries as established by Ordinance No.
10820 are not coterminus with state legislative district
boundaries :
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ENACTED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F
JEFFERSON, MISSOURI , AS FOLLOWS:
SECTION 1. Subsections (e ) and (f ) of Section 11-36 of the
Code of the City of Jefferson, Missouri, are hereby repealed and
new subsections (e ) and (f ) of Section 11--36 are hereby enacted,
which shall read as follows :
Section 11-36 Wards
(e ) The Fourth Ward shall be bounded as follows:
Beginning at a point where the western corporate
limits is intersected by the centerline of U.S.
Route 50; thence easterly along the centerline of
U.S. Route 50 to the centerline of Dix Road;
thence southerly along the centerline of Dix Road
to the centerline of William Street; thence
easterly along the centerline of William Street to
the centerline of Beck Street; thence northerly
along the centerline of Beck Street to the
centerline of St . Marys Boulevard; thence easterly
along the centerline of St. Marys Boulevard to the
centerline of Waverly Street; thence southerly
along the centerline of Waverly Street to the
centerline of Missouri Boulevard; thence easterly
to the centerline of U.S. Route 54 ; thence
southeasterly along the centerline of U.S. Route
54 to the centerline of Tanner Bridge Road; thence
continuing southeasterly along the centerline of

Tanner Bridge Road to the north line of Section
25 , Township 44 North, Range 12 West, Cole County,
Missouri; thence westerly along said north line to
the corporate city limits line; thence along and
with the corporate city limits , as defined in
section 1-17, by the shortest route to the point
of beginning.
(f) The Fifth Ward shall be bounded as follows :
Beginning at a point where the centerline of
Monroe Street is intersected by the centerline of
East Ashley Street; thence southerly along the
centerline of Monroe Street to the centerline of
Stadium Boulevard; thence westerly along the
centerline of Stadium Boulevard to the centerline
of U. S. Route 54; thence southwesterly along the
centerline of U.S. Route 54 to the centerline of
Tanner Bridge Road; thence continuing
southwesterly along the centerline of Tanner
Bridge Road to the north line of Section 25,
Township 44 North, Range 12 West , Cole County,
Missouri; thence westerly along said north line to
the corporate city limits line; thence along the
corporate city limits line , as defined in section
1-17, by the shortest route to the southerly
right-of-way of U.S Route 50 (Mo. Project F-
1( 12 ) ) ; thence westerly along the southerly right-
of-way line of U.S. Route 50 to the intersection
of the northerly line of Private Survey #2440,
Township 44 , Range 11; thence northerly parallel
to the easterly line of Section 21 to the
centerline of U.S. Route 50; thence westerly along
the centerline of the aforementioned U.S. Route 50
to the centerline of Jackson Street; thence
southerly along the centerline of Jackson Street
to the centerline of East Ashley Street; thence
westerly along the centerline of East Ashley
Street to the point of beginning.

STAFF REPORT
PROPOSED CHANGE IN THE BOUNDARY
BETWEEN THE FOURTH AND FIFTH WARDS
When the proposed South Annexation Area was taken into the
City, the division line between the Fourth and Fifth Wards was
simply continued down Tanner Bridge Road. This placed most of
the annexed land and population in the Fifth Ward. That small
area west of Tanner Bridge Road was placed in the Fourth Ward;
there are 5 or 6 houses in this small area. If left in the
Fourth Ward, these 5 or 6 houses would be the only houses in the
Fourth Ward which are in the 113th District. If this proposed
boundary change is passed, everyone in the newly-annexed south
area will be in the Fifth Precinct of the Fifth Ward and all will
continue to be in the 113th District.
See attached letter from the County Clerk' s Office. If the
change in boundary is made, it is the County Clerk' s
responsibility to notify affected registered voters.

Since the City of Jefferson recently annexed a track. of Zane
southeast of the old City Limits on Tanner Bridge Road, it is
necessary for the Cole County Clerk's Office to set up a new
precinct in the 5th Ward, which will be Ward 5, Precinct 5.
It''s my understanding that the City will have to change the•
description of the foundry of the 5th. Ward to include the' newly
annexed area, after the proposal has- been approved by the City
Council.
The. newly annexed area is in the 113th. District. Because' of thin,
we. could not just move. the voters into an existing ward and precinct
which would have changed their Representative District.
